New games coming to Xbox Game Pass
According to the official announcement, a total of five games will be added to the Xbox Game Pass library in the coming weeks. The lineup includes some popular titles, such as Call of Duty: Vanguard, EA Sports FC 26, RV There Yet?, and more. On top of that, one of the games that was already available on Game Pass is now being expanded to the Premium plan.
In any case, here are all the games coming to Game Pass in the second half of June 2026, along with their availability dates.
| Game name | Date available | Game Pass plan | Platforms |
| Call of Duty: Vanguard | June 17 | Game Pass Ultimate, Game Pass Premium, PC Game Pass | Cloud, Console, and PC |
| EA Sports FC 26 | June 18 | Game Pass Ultimate, PC Game Pass | Cloud, Console, and PC |
| Abyssus | June 25 | Game Pass Ultimate, Game Pass Premium, PC Game Pass | Cloud, XBOX Series X|S, and PC |
| RV There Yet? | June 30 | Game Pass Ultimate, Game Pass Premium, PC Game Pass | Cloud, XBOX Series X|S, and PC |
| Tony Hawk’s Pro Skater 3 + 4 | July 2 | Now with Game Pass Premium; joining Game Pass Ultimate and PC Game Pass | Cloud, Console, and PC |
| Winds of Arcana: Ruination | July 6 | Game Pass Ultimate, Game Pass Premium, PC Game Pass | Cloud, Console, Handheld, and PC |
